## v3.2.0 — Setting renamed

`FEEDCHECK_STRICT` is now `VALIDATOR_STRICT_MODE`. The old name is accepted until v3.4 with a deprecation warning in logs; after that, Podlint will refuse to start. Support: if a customer reports validation suddenly passing malformed feeds, check for the old key first — it silently defaults to lenient.

Update customer `.env` files to the new name. The validator's webhook signing secret belongs on the line immediately below.

vault entry, yahif-yajep: COURIER_KEY29=b802bdf8034096b65a51c6ba5abe2

Ticket: Descriptor leak in Murkfell sync daemon

Welcome, new folks — this one's a good starter. The Murkfell daemon slowly exhausts file descriptors after ~48 hours under load; lsof snapshots suggest unclosed pipe pairs from the retry path. Reproduce with the harness in the toolbox repo and attach your descriptor diffs. The trace token from the last confirmed repro appears below.

session token of tajef-bageg = htk21_5d90d574934f3ccae6437

Minutes — Management Meeting, Quillden Labs

Attendees: T. Marrow (Chair), E. Sovel, K. Drenn.

The launch plan for the Fernlight platform was reviewed in detail. Beta feedback is positive; two stability issues remain open. Marketing assets are approved pending legal review. Launch window holds for early next quarter, staged by region, starting with Ashmere. The incoming director should note dependencies on supply commitments. Strategic context is provided below.

confidential, yagep-kagef: Rusvanox Holdings is in early talks to buy Julwynix Systems for about $454.5 million. The Fenael launch date is April 23, and nothing goes to the press before then. Legal wants the Druwynix Works term sheet redrafted before January 8.

## Artifact Signing — Telemetry Compression Pipeline

For the weekly sync: the Gransole telemetry compressor now emits zstd payloads by default. All compressor builds are signed before rollout to the Ostvale collector fleet. Unsigned builds fail the Pinloft admission check and are quarantined. Compression ratio regressions do not block signing but must be noted in the release log. Rotation happens quarterly; last rotation completed without incident. Open item: automate manifest diffing. Verification for this cycle uses the key directly below.

signing key of bagap-yawep = bky13_TbfT6ZMUoGJo2